Rejected petition Re-read the Cannabis (Legalisation & Regulation) Bill 2015/16 in the Commons.
On the 23rd of May 2016 the Cannabis Bill was introduced to parliament but failed to go all the way due to it being close to the end of the parliamentary year. I want to show my support as well as the support of the British public in this historic fight to lay the foundation for reform.

This petition was rejected
Why was this petition rejected?
It’s not clear what the petition is asking the UK Government or Parliament to do.
It's not clear what is meant by "re-reading" a Bill.
If you would like Parliament to change the law on cannabis, you could start a new petition asking for that - or you may find that there is already a petition open on our site which you would like to sign instead.
